As of my last update in October 2023, Isaac Herzog was serving as the President of Israel, having taken office in July 2021. The role of the president in Israel is largely ceremonial and does not involve direct policy-making powers, so the president's political stance is less influential compared to that of the prime minister and the government.
Herzog is a member of the Labor Party and has generally been seen as centrist. He has expressed support for democratic values, social justice, and coexistence, but his statements and positions are often aligned with broader public consensus rather than being extremely partisan.
